Output 35bf65191ce09cee5ccab59380940784e2656f545f2c8aca24ee792c4ee2dd26:1

value
21667232
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39ccf8c1966aa79d1768468a6a24949c79324260 OP_EQUAL
address
MDAnJ3kLnDHQkiuBy8N3nknmsvxVa2c7zM
transaction
35bf65191ce09cee5ccab59380940784e2656f545f2c8aca24ee792c4ee2dd26
spent
true